Marc Morano talks about his decades covering climate politics and his view that the climate movement is in rapid collapse due to overreach, public skepticism, and post-COVID distrust of “appeal to authority.” Morano contrasts Trump 1.0’s limited actions with Trump 2.0’s aggressive agenda: hundreds of pro-energy moves, exits from numerous UN bodies, a push to end the EPA CO2 endangerment finding, and a consensus-busting climate report later vacated over procedural issues. He says Democrats, media, Wall Street, and major figures like Bezos and Gates have gone quiet or shifted, while UN COP summits have become smaller and scandal-prone.
